Variation Characteristics of Water Temperatures at Different Depths of Fishpond

Abstract: In order to ensure the creatures safe living through winter and summer by scientific regulation of water temperature of fishpond, water temperatures of different vertical layers of fishpond and the shore air temperature were researched at different time scales from March 2011 to February 2012 in Wuhan. The results showed that diurnal change trend of water temperatures at different depths of the fishpond was in consistent with that of the shore air temperature which had relatively smaller amplitude. The amplitude of air temperature and water temperature of each layer under clear weather was significantly greater than that of cloudy days. Monthly averaged air temperature and water temperature of each layer increased from March to July, especially in April. Water temperature decreasing with increasing depth was significantly obvious under clear weather than that under cloudy days. The monthly averaged air temperature and water temperature of each layer decreased from August to February of the next year, especially in January. The variation of water temperature with depth took on fall- rise- fall or fall- rise modes. On the seasonal scale, the decreasing rate of water temperature with increasing depth decreased from spring to autumn. Water temperature with increasing depth presented a fall-rise-fall mode in winter. The results could provide guidance for the scientific management of fish ponds in Wuhan, and could also lay foundation of water temperature forecast for aquaculture.
